I would assume that the 5 spd. would win the contest, unless you get the VB mod on the transmission for the auto. I know the difference on the 95's Manuals are close to a second faster in the 0-60 area than the autos. I assume that this range should go about the same for all model years. The 2K may have more horsepower, but it isn't enough to make up for the differences in transmissions.

No question, the 5-spd will win if the driver has decent skills. 5-spd 4th gens have 0-60 of 7.1s, and auto 5th gens have 0-60 in the 8s range.
